Output 516967ccafa3705ccbfccddf6d545d4337adf3e98ef7adfb0a3bec960e02fe91:12

value
707614
script pubkey
OP_0 OP_PUSHBYTES_20 d7a58179c93d84eeb88e5c9e1a3cd5fa22905bca
address
bc1q67jcz7wf8kzwawywtj0p50x4lg3fqk72u3u8q6
transaction
516967ccafa3705ccbfccddf6d545d4337adf3e98ef7adfb0a3bec960e02fe91
spent
false